Output 598587d7703558808e20f0e14883db940021c60b73be8fd4bcd04f65b2d257e5:124

value
204251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ed9a2e68e9a60b4a280f61cc6dac1ff411c3f16 OP_EQUAL
address
3ALYADKKLaHqgXcXL3uuebjkuYa7E2E61B
transaction
598587d7703558808e20f0e14883db940021c60b73be8fd4bcd04f65b2d257e5
spent
true